pub struct SerializableCryptoKey {
pub key_type: String,
pub extractable: bool,
pub algorithm: SerializableKeyAlgorithmAndDerivatives,
pub usages: Vec<String>,
pub handle: SerializableCryptoKeyHandle,
}Expand description
A serializable version of the CryptoKey interface.
